Output 3d80af6c8f21d2474672d955c1e2e7e4401766249f8a82de385bccf0d81e2150:0

value
4557000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ef40b2e654dafce828dd661c2ced9940e9b029f OP_EQUALVERIFY OP_CHECKSIG
address
18CU4R439Ri9aKdP2wWLm5z1HKUpxaHDGr
transaction
3d80af6c8f21d2474672d955c1e2e7e4401766249f8a82de385bccf0d81e2150
spent
true